    Manual: Speed Sensor MSPEED 1. Introduction MSPEED is a sensor which measures the speed of a flying model through the air, to provide the indicated airspeed (IAS). The reporting of airspeed can be very instructive with regard to the control of a flying model, for example allowing the pilot to determine the models stall speed and set an alarm to indicate when the model falls below this speed.

    Low speed Al. – The speed below which an alarm condition should be raised. 5. Installation The main MSPEED sensor unit can be placed directly in the fuselage or installed in the wings. Please avoid direct contact of heat sources, such as batteries, controllers and regulators. The pitot tube must be installed outside zones of airflow directly behind propellers.
